About The Position

We are seeking a highly skilled and detail-oriented Compliance Program Administrator with a strong background in hospital billing compliance to join our Healthcare Compliance team. The ideal candidate will have at least five (5) years of experience in hospital billing compliance, with in-depth knowledge of Medicaid Recovery Audit Contractor (RAC) processes, payer guidelines, and the regulatory frameworks governing healthcare reimbursement. This role plays a critical part in ensuring that our institution maintains full compliance with federal and state regulations, payer requirements, and internal policies related to billing, coding, and documentation.

Responsibilities

  • Lead and manage the hospital billing compliance program across inpatient and outpatient services.
  • Perform risk-based evaluations of internal and external compliance trends to inform program focus areas.
  • Monitor and interpret Medicaid Recovery Audit Contractor (RAC) activity, including appeals and corrective actions.
  • Ensure adherence to payer-specific guidelines, including Medicare, Medicaid, and commercial payers.
  • Conduct internal audits, monitor activities, and risk assessments to identify billing and coding discrepancies.
  • Collaborate with Revenue Cycle, Revenue Integrity, Health Information Management Services (HIMS), and clinical departments to resolve compliance issues.
  • Establish and maintain a role as a trusted partner and subject matter expert with key stakeholders and compliance collaborators.
  • Develop and deliver training programs on billing compliance, RAC audits, and payer regulations.
  • Maintain current knowledge of CPT, HCPCS, ICD-10, and other coding standards.
  • Prepare and present compliance reports to senior leadership.
  • Support responses to external audits and regulatory inquiries.
  • Assist in policy development and updates based on regulatory changes and institutional needs.
